My Personal Trainer (Keeps you accountable and tracking)
A Personal Trainer can be your wake up call into realising how much you really eat and drink daily, and how much exercise it takes to lose weight. Your very own personal trainer will help motivate and get you going. Your Personal trainer will:
- Assist in tracking all food and drinks consumed daily, and the amount of exercise.
- Will help you identify certain food and drinks which are high in calories, points, fat, sugar, and carbohydrates.
- Will help identify different moods and occurrences that lead to overeating, so that you can plan towards avoiding them.
- Will keep you on track preventing yoyo weight fluctuations, plateaus, due to food amnesia "forgot I had that to eat syndrome"
- Disciplines you to think before you eat.
- Allows you to plan your daily meals and exercise more effectively to lose weight.
- The analysis reports received by you from PT may be used by your doctor or health professional as an assessment tool in achieving better health.
